Nepal : India U-19 boys start their SAFF U-19 Campaign with a dominant 3-0 win over Bangladesh U-19 at Dashrath Stadium, Kathmandu, Nepal.

Gwgwmsar Goyary, Naoba Meitei Pangambam and Arjun Singh Oinam were the scorers as India look to qualify for the knockout stages from Group B.
India dominated Bangladesh from the very start as Gwgwmsar Goyary found the net in the very first minute. The 2nd goal of India came in the additional time of the 1st half off a left footer by Naoba Meitei.
In the 2nd half, continuing their powerful attack and defence, India kept dominating Bangladesh , however, Bangladesh didn’t concede any goal, until the 90th minute, when they skillfully played series of passes allowing Arjun Singh Oinam to score his 1st , and defeat Bangladesh with a scoreline 3-0.
A dominant start will be enough to ask for before their Match against Bhutan on September 25.
